"JV Begins Development of 50-Acre Boynton Beach Business Park"

A new industrial facility is set to begin construction in Boynton Beach, thanks to a recent partnership that has acquired 47.2 acres of land in the Agricultural Reserve area. The joint venture between Butters Construction & Development and Channing Corp., along with Sudler Companies and Woodmont Industrial Partners, has purchased the land from Valico Nurseries and individual property owners for a total of $29.75 million.

The project, known as “The District,” will feature 519,000 square feet of office space, showrooms, warehouses,and small bay industrial units. Additionally,a self-storage facility spanning 140,000 square feet will also be included on the site’s seven buildings ranging from 21-124 thousand square feet.

Arcadia Architects have been enlisted to design this ambitious development which aims to cater towards businesses looking for smaller industrial spaces starting at approximately4 ,000 square feet.The team behind this project is confident that it will bring significant economic growth opportunities for Boynton Beach and its surrounding areas.
